The chemical foam extinguisher was invented in 1904 by Aleksandr Loran in Russia, according to his prior creation of fire fighting foam. Loran 1st employed it to extinguish a pan of burning naphtha.[six] It labored and appeared comparable to the soda-acid style, nevertheless the interior components were a little various. The primary tank contained a solution of sodium bicarbonate in drinking water, even though here the inner container (fairly bigger compared to equivalent inside a soda-acid device) contained a solution of aluminium sulphate. If the methods had been mixed, ordinarily by inverting the unit, The 2 liquids reacted to make a frothy foam, and carbon dioxide gas. The gas expelled the foam in the form of the jet. Whilst liquorice-root extracts and comparable compounds were employed as additives (stabilizing the foam by reinforcing the bubble-partitions), there was no "foam compound" in these models.

One more type of carbon tetrachloride extinguisher was the fire grenade. This consisted of the glass sphere crammed with CTC, that was intended to be hurled at the base of the fire (early ones employed salt-water, but CTC was more effective). Carbon tetrachloride was suitable for liquid and electrical fires and also the extinguishers were being fitted to motor automobiles.
